First Ever Day of the Dead Festival in Central Park
Bring your family and friends to Henderson’s first Dia de los Muertos festival this Saturday from 4-7pm.
This vibrant Mexican holiday originated several thousand years ago and celebrates the lives of those
who have passed on through food, drink, and celebration. It’s not spooky- it’s a fun, colorful, and family-friendly festival!
Activities and events include:
-Traditional dancers
-Mariachi band
-Crafts + face painting
-Traditional cultural activities, including ofrendas (temporary altars) + a candlelight procession + pop-up grave-site celebrations
-Food trucks + beer garden
Free admission!
